Spaces:
Running
on
CPU Upgrade
Running
on
CPU Upgrade
test
Browse files
app.py
CHANGED
@@ -148,6 +148,7 @@ async def add_exp(member_id, message):
|
|
148 |
|
149 |
guild = bot.get_guild(879548962464493619)
|
150 |
member = guild.get_member(member_id)
|
|
|
151 |
lvl1 = guild.get_role(1171861537699397733)
|
152 |
lvl2 = guild.get_role(1171861595115245699)
|
153 |
lvl3 = guild.get_role(1171861626715115591)
|
@@ -219,19 +220,17 @@ async def add_exp(member_id, message):
|
|
219 |
#await member.send(f"Level up! {current_level-1} -> {current_level}!")
|
220 |
if member_id == 811235357663297546:
|
221 |
|
222 |
-
|
223 |
-
member_id = member.id
|
224 |
-
row = global_df[global_df['discord_user_id'] == str(member_id)] # does this need to be string?
|
225 |
if not row.empty:
|
226 |
target_exp = row['discord_exp'].values[0]
|
227 |
rank = (global_df['discord_exp'] > target_exp).sum() + 1
|
228 |
-
print(f"The rank for discord_id {
|
229 |
else:
|
230 |
-
print(f"Discord ID {
|
231 |
|
232 |
# send embed
|
233 |
embed = Embed(color=Color.blue())
|
234 |
-
embed.set_author(name=f"{
|
235 |
embed.title = f"Level Up! `{current_level-1}` -> `{current_level}`"
|
236 |
msg = 'Congrats! You just leveled up in the Hugging Face Discord server'
|
237 |
embed.description = f"{msg}."
|
|
|
148 |
|
149 |
guild = bot.get_guild(879548962464493619)
|
150 |
member = guild.get_member(member_id)
|
151 |
+
member2 = guild.get_member(message.content)
|
152 |
lvl1 = guild.get_role(1171861537699397733)
|
153 |
lvl2 = guild.get_role(1171861595115245699)
|
154 |
lvl3 = guild.get_role(1171861626715115591)
|
|
|
220 |
#await member.send(f"Level up! {current_level-1} -> {current_level}!")
|
221 |
if member_id == 811235357663297546:
|
222 |
|
223 |
+
row = global_df[global_df['discord_user_id'] == str(member2.id)] # does this need to be string?
|
|
|
|
|
224 |
if not row.empty:
|
225 |
target_exp = row['discord_exp'].values[0]
|
226 |
rank = (global_df['discord_exp'] > target_exp).sum() + 1
|
227 |
+
print(f"The rank for discord_id {member2.id} based on discord_exp is: {rank}")
|
228 |
else:
|
229 |
+
print(f"Discord ID {member2.id} not found in the DataFrame.")
|
230 |
|
231 |
# send embed
|
232 |
embed = Embed(color=Color.blue())
|
233 |
+
embed.set_author(name=f"{member2}", icon_url=member2.avatar.url if member2.avatar else bot.user.avatar.url)
|
234 |
embed.title = f"Level Up! `{current_level-1}` -> `{current_level}`"
|
235 |
msg = 'Congrats! You just leveled up in the Hugging Face Discord server'
|
236 |
embed.description = f"{msg}."
|